Job Responsibilities and Requirements:

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ES
• Prepares and distributes work schedules and task assignments for the assigned group. Evaluates requests for time off and schedule changes and approves or declines according to policy. Works with department leadership to ensure staffing levels are adequate to meet needs. Coordinates changes to schedules due to sick calls, leave of absence or other emergent changes in staff availability or work volume. Advises supervisor of any potential policy violations related to attendance or schedules.
• Guides and leads co-workers in consistently using established aseptic cleaning protocol. Educates new staff to policies and procedures and re-educates staff when quality concerns are noted.
• Identifies and responds to breakdowns in workflow or backlogs of work that could lead to poor customer service. Alerts leadership when immediate action is necessary, suggests alternatives to immediately address the issue and re-prioritize tasks to clear backlogs and respond to rushes.
• Assists the supervisor with onboarding of new staff, ensuring mandatory education completion, developing and presenting training and providing input to performance evaluations.
• Recommends and implements changes to workflow, work assignments, and team organization to ensure high-quality 24-hour service. Monitors the performance and quality of assigned staff's work to achieve established levels of service and provide timely and regular feedback.
• Participates in process improvement, development, implementation, evaluation, and monitoring of new processes. Leads others during the implementation of changes in a positive manner and through modeling expected behaviors and actions.
• Works in a constant state of alertness and safe manner.
• Performs other duties as assigned.

EDUCATION

EXPERIENCE
• One year experience

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S
• Constant standing and walking.
• Frequent lifting/carrying and pushing/pulling objects weighing 0-25 lbs.
• Frequent reaching and gripping.
• Frequent use of vision and depth perception for distances near (20 inches or less) and far (20 feet or more) and to identify and distinguish colors.
• Occasional bending, stooping, climbing, kneeling, squatting, twisting and repetitive foot/leg and hand/arm movements.
• Occasional lifting/carrying and pushing/pulling objects weighing 25-50 lbs.
• Occasional use of hearing and speech to share information through oral communication. Ability to hear alarms, malfunctioning machinery, etc.
• Occasional use of smell to detect/recognize odors.
• Rare crawling, sitting and keyboard use/data entry.

REQUIRED PROFESSIONAL LICENSE AND/OR CERTIFICATIONS
• None
